Viral meningitis

Index Viral meningitis

Viral meningitis, also known as aseptic meningitis, is a type of meningitis due to a viral infection. [1]

Lumbar puncture

Lumbar puncture (LP), also known as a spinal tap, is a medical procedure in which a needle is inserted into the spinal canal, most commonly to collect c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) for diagnostic testing.
